Output 41c66bd07ae5807e360e34dc271a3a191c654f634762be23afc5eb188b30995d:0

value
3155066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f8688e23094c92b03aabfa3cf21307c7d7395bf OP_EQUALVERIFY OP_CHECKSIG
address
1KvJ3LwdBAzB1megFQn7MmxxrZy9sCLpTv
transaction
41c66bd07ae5807e360e34dc271a3a191c654f634762be23afc5eb188b30995d
spent
true